Abstract

Purpose

With the rapid advancement in the automotive industry, the friction coefficient (FC), wear rate (WR) and weight loss (WL) have emerged as crucial parameters to measure the performance of automotive braking systems, so the FC, WR and WL of friction material are predicted and analyzed in this work, with an aim of achieving accurate prediction of friction material properties.

Design/methodology/approach

Genetic algorithm support vector machine (GA-SVM) model is obtained by applying GA to optimize the SVM in this work, thus establishing a prediction model for friction material properties and achieving the predictive and comparative analysis of friction material properties. The process parameters are analyzed by using response surface methodology (RSM) and GA-RSM to determine them for optimal friction performance.

Findings

The results indicate that the GA-SVM prediction model has the smallest error for FC, WR and WL, showing that it owns excellent prediction accuracy. The predicted values obtained by response surface analysis are closed to those of GA-SVM model, providing further evidence of the validity and the rationality of the established prediction model.

Originality/value

The relevant results can serve as a valuable theoretical foundation for the preparation of friction material in engineering practice.

Abstract

Purpose

When solving the cogging torque of complex electromagnetic structures, such as consequent pole hybrid excitation synchronous (CPHES) machine, traditional methods have a huge computational complexity. The notable feature of CPHES machine is the symmetric range of field-strengthening and field-weakening, but this type of machine is destined to be equipped with a complex electromagnetic structure. The purpose of this paper is to propose a hybrid analysis method to quickly and accurately solve the cogging torque of complex 3D electromagnetic structure, which is applicable to CPHES machine with different magnetic pole shapings.

Design/methodology/approach

In this paper, a hybrid method for calculating the cogging torque of CPHES machine is proposed, which considers three commonly used pole shapings. Firstly, through magnetic field analysis, the complex 3D finite element analysis (FEA) is simplified to 2D field computing. Secondly, the discretization method is used to obtain the distribution of permeance and permeance differential along the circumference of the air-gap, taking into account the effect of slots. Finally, the cogging torque of the whole motor is obtained by using the idea of modular calculation and the symmetry of the rotor structure.

Findings

This method is applicable to different pole shapings. The experimental results show that the proposed method is consistent with 3D FEA and experimental measured results, and the average calculation time is reduced from 8 h to 4 min.

Originality/value

This paper proposes a new concept for calculating cogging torque, which is a hybrid calculation of dimension reduction and discretization modules. Based on magnetic field analysis, the 3D problem is simplified into a 2D issue, reducing computational complexity. Based on the symmetry of the machine structure, a modeling method for discretized analytical models is proposed to calculate the cogging torque of the machine.

Abstract

Purpose

This paper aims to present a systematic literature review of 176 studies relating to change management in the context of process optimization and to investigate how companies effectively use change management to optimize processes across different industrial sectors.

Design/methodology/approach

Descriptive statistics are used to represent patterns, trends and correlations between change management strategies, research methods applied for processes optimization and industry field. A comprehensive analysis of the papers’ keywords, crossed with research methods and industrial sectors, allowed us to substantiate the results in analytic terms. For some selected studies, chosen on the basis of their significance to the research field, the contents were mapped and discussed in detail.

Findings

This study provides numerous insights into the various applications of change management across different industry fields. In general, change management appears to be no longer a theoretical discipline, showing instead practical relevance, which is reflected in testing theories through case studies and real implementations. The review emphasizes the need for careful and systemic planning by companies, effective communication, employee involvement and supportive organizational culture. These factors are crucial for enhancing process efficiency and employee acceptance of change. Digital technologies also prove to be valuable support for change management during process optimization.

Originality/value

The innovative contribution of this paper consists of the joint perspective taken when looking at process optimization and the application of change management strategies. Such a perspective favors an in-depth examination of the interactions between the two aspects and provides more comprehensive results compared to the existing literature.

Abstract

Purpose

This research is the first to use bibliometric analysis to provide insight into the landscape and forecast the future of customer experience research in the banking sector.

Design/methodology/approach

We used bibliographic coupling and co-word analysis to delineate the existing knowledge structure after reviewing 338 articles from the Web of Science database.

Findings

The bibliographic coupling analysis revealed five key clusters: customer engagement and experience in digital banking; customer experience and service management; customer experience and market resilience; digital transformation and customer experience; and digital technology and customer experience—each representing a significant strand of current research. In addition, the co-word analysis revealed four emerging themes: customer experience through AI and blockchain, digital evolution in banking, experience-driven ecosystems for customer satisfaction, and trust-based holistic banking experience.

Practical implications

These findings not only sketch an overview of the current research domain but also hint at emerging areas ideal for scholarly investigation. While highlighting the industry’s rapid adaptation to technological advances, this study calls for more integrative research to unravel the complexities of customer experience in the evolving digital banking ecosystem.

Originality/value

This review presents a novel state-of-the-art analysis of customer banking experience research by employing a science mapping via bibliometric analysis to unveil the knowledge and temporal structure.

Abstract

Purpose

This study aims to provide a comprehensive overview of pro-environmental behavior (PEB) research within higher education institutions (HEIs), highlighting current trends and future challenges.

Design/methodology/approach

Using 198 journal articles from the Web of Science, the study conducts co-citation, bibliographic coupling and co-word analyses to map influential publications and forecast trends.

Findings

The co-citation analysis revealed three distinct clusters: value-driven environmental behavior, intention-based environmental behavior and green organizational practices and employee PEB. The bibliographic coupling and the co-word analysis revealed more nuanced clusters, holistically identifying academic activities towards PEB. The authors conclude that more strategic and PEB-oriented HEI’s actions are crucial due to the social responsibility of the universities for sustainable development.

Originality/value

This paper provides valuable insights into the expanding area of PEB research and climate leadership empowerment within HEIs. The practical implications of this research are significant for HEIs. It guides the creation of effective policies and interventions to foster sustainable behavior and reduce environmental harm. The study shows the development of educational programs and campaigns promoting sustainable practices among individuals and communities, emphasizing the role of HEIs in cultivating a sustainability-conscious generation.

Abstract

Purpose

This study aims to measure impact of several firm-specific factors on alternative measures of leverage. The authors also aim to study impact of the subprime crisis on such associations.

Design/methodology/approach

The authors utilized an unbalanced panel data of 973 firm-year observations on 47 UK listed non-financial firms for the years 1990–2019. Book-based and market-based long-term and total leverage measures have been used as explained variables. The explanatory variables are profitability, size, two measures of growth, asset tangibility, non-debt tax shields, firm age and product uniqueness. Fixed effect and random effect models with clustered robust standard errors have been utilized for data analysis. To find the effect of subprime crisis, original dataset was split to create pre-crisis and post-crisis datasets.

Findings

The authors find that profitability significantly reduces leverage while firms having more tangible assets use significantly more debt in capital structure. Firm size and non-debt tax shield have statistically insignificant positive impact on leverage. Having more unique products reduces use of external debt, albeit insignificantly. Growth, when measured as market-to-book ratio, has inconsistent impact, whereas capital expenditure insignificantly reduces leverage. Age is found to be an insignificant predictor of leverage. After the subprime crisis, firms started relying more on internal fund instead of external debt, more particularly short-term debt. Having more collateral is gradually becoming more important for availing external debt.

Research limitations/implications

Data limitations restrict generalization of the findings.

Originality/value

This is one of the pioneering attempts to show how subprime crisis altered the theoretical domain of capital structure research in the UK.
